[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of digital electronic circuits, and in particular to a two-ticket system based on digital circuits. Background Art

[0002] Two-article management and two-ticket management are implemented in power station maintenance in order to strictly implement the "Electric Power Safety Work Regulations". Combined with the problems existing in the implementation of work tickets at this station, this regulation is specially formulated to achieve further standardization, unification and standardization, and to improve the quality and pass rate of work tickets and switching operation tickets.

[0003] At present, there are still many power station maintenance offices that use two management methods, which are implemented through paper work tickets and operation tickets. When setting maintenance projects, the department that prepares the work ticket needs to record each maintenance detail on the work ticket, and each maintenance detail will also be recorded on the operation ticket. When the executor completes each project, he needs to mark the corresponding number. When the maintenance projects are numerous or complex, the executor may miss or make mistakes, which may pose a hidden danger to the maintenance of the power station or the safety of electricity use. [0023] As the instruction manual Figure 1 and 2 As shown, a two-ticket system based on digital circuits includes multiple independent and parallel switch groups. The enabled switch groups are related to the number of items in the work ticket. Each switch group includes a first switch module and a second switch module. The outputs of the first switch module and the second switch module are connected by a first logic module. After the output of the first logic module, the output of each enabled switch group is connected to the input of the second AND logic module, and the output of the second AND logic module is used as the total output.

[0024] When the engineer arranges the work ticket, he activates the first switch module according to the number of items in the work ticket. When the first switch module is activated, the prompt device of the first switch module will give a sound or light prompt, usually a light, indicating that the switch group is activated. When the operator performs maintenance in sequence, each time a task is completed, the second switch module is activated. When the state of the second switch module changes, the prompt after the first switch module will change.

[0025] As the instruction manual Figure 2 As shown, the switch group includes a resistor R1 and a diode D1, the front end of the first switch module is connected to a first voltage source, the front end of the second switch module is connected to the first voltage source through the resistor R1, the output end of the first switch module is connected to the output end of the second switch module through the diode D1, and the diode D1 points from the first switch module to the second switch module.

[0026] Before starting the first switch module, the first switch module is open circuit and the second switch module is grounded. When the first switch module is turned on, the first switch module is connected, the anode of the diode D1 is at a high potential, and the cathode of the diode D1 is grounded at the same time. At this time, the input of the second AND logic module is grounded. At this time, one input of the second AND drain module is 0, indicating that the project is not completed. For the switch group that is not enabled, it is necessary to use a switch to disconnect the switch group from the second AND logic module. Ordinary switches or switch tubes can be used to achieve the disconnection. When completing an item in the maintenance execution operation ticket, the corresponding second switch module is triggered, and the second switch module is connected to the first voltage source. At this time, the input of the second AND logic module is high potential. When the output of all switch groups is high potential, the second AND logic module outputs a high potential. When the second AND logic module outputs a low potential, it indicates that there is an unfinished project in the operation ticket.

[0027] As the instruction manual Figure 2 As shown, the second AND logic module includes multiple parallel diodes and a second voltage source. The number of diodes in the second AND logic module matches the number of switch groups. The voltage of the second voltage source is lower than that of the first voltage source. The anodes of the diodes in the second AND logic module are connected to the second voltage source, and the cathode of each diode in the second AND logic module is connected to the output of the corresponding switch group. The subsequent stage of the two-ticket system is connected to a prompt unit. This second AND logic unit is implemented using multiple parallel diodes.

[0028] As the instruction manual Figure 2 As shown, the first switch module is connected to a light-emitting diode (LED1) at the rear stage, with the anode of the LED connected to the first switch module. When the first switch module is not activated, the anode of the LED is open, and no current flows through the LED. When the LED is activated, diode D1 is grounded, forming a path between the first voltage source and the power ground after passing through the LED, causing the LED to emit light, thus providing a prompt. When the second switch module is connected to the first voltage source, the cathode of diode D1 rises to a high potential, turning off the LED.

[0029] As the instruction manual Figure 4As shown, the second switch module includes a single-pole double-throw switch. The switch side of the single-pole double-throw switch serves as the V2 end of the second switch module. The first contact on the contact side of the single-pole double-throw switch is connected to the first voltage source, and the second contact on the contact side of the single-pole double-throw switch is connected to the power ground.

[0030] As the instruction manual Figure 5 As shown, the second switch module includes a transistor Q1 and a transistor Q2, the transistor Q1 is an npn-type transistor, the transistor Q2 is a pnp-type transistor, the bases of the transistor Q1 and the transistor Q2 are connected in parallel to an external control signal, the collector of the transistor Q1 is connected to a first voltage source, the emitter of the transistor Q1 is connected to the V2 end of the second switch module, the emitter of the transistor Q2 is connected to the V2 end of the second switch module, and the collector of the transistor Q2 is connected to the power ground.

[0031] The second switch module is electronically triggered, with an external trigger module. When the input Von is high, transistor Q1 conducts, connecting the voltage of the first voltage source through transistor Q1 and V2 to a high voltage. At this point, Q2 is disconnected, isolating V2 from the power supply ground. When Von is low, transistor Q1 disconnects the first voltage source and V2, while transistor Q2 conducts, grounding V2.
